Output 172cb8fac2c6f807d6531971da9b88f3c66b6920c275721a39670cccbbe9b3a9:3

value
5926154
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6ce78a7f51976e4f4bfef89d2cb3346620a62552 OP_EQUAL
address
3BcrH1gNQABvKMuinbomfP8jLYJQUsrboK
transaction
172cb8fac2c6f807d6531971da9b88f3c66b6920c275721a39670cccbbe9b3a9
confirmations
340817
spent
true